Let's explore the opportunities in this vibrant sector by examining the: 1. **Theatre Director**: Demand for skilled Theatre Directors is robust, accounting for 25% of the sector. A Theatre Director's primary responsibility is to ensure the creative vision of a production is executed effectively and efficiently. 2. **Stage Manager**: Making up 20% of the industry, Stage Managers play a crucial role in the day-to-day operations of a theatre production. Responsibilities include coordinating rehearsals, managing the technical aspects of productions, and supervising the backstage crew. 3. **Lighting Designer**: Lighting Designers constitute 15% of the job market. They create and implement striking lighting designs to enhance the overall aesthetic and emotional impact of a theatre performance. 4. **Sound Designer**: With 10% of job opportunities, Sound Designers are in charge of designing and implementing the audio aspects of theatre productions. This role requires a keen ear for detail and a creative flair. 5. **Costume Designer**: Also representing 10% of the industry, Costume Designers design, source, and create the costumes for a theatre production. This role demands a strong sense of creativity and an understanding of historical fashion. 6. **Playwright**: Completing the 3D pie chart with 20% of job opportunities, Playwrights write engaging and thought-provoking scripts for theatre performances. This role requires a strong command of language, a vivid imagination, and an innate understanding of human emotions.
